Process Workflow

1. Heat Conduction Plate Loading2. Terminal Tab Cutting Inspection3. Cell Loading
4. Cell Glue Applying5. Terminal Tab Bracket Assemblying6. Cell Insulation Testing
7. Unit Glue Applying8. Module Stacking9. Busbar Installation
10. Terminal Tab Bending11. Terminal Tab Flatting12. NG Cell Re-work
13. Insulation Testing14. Laser Welding15. Post-Welding Testing
16. Double-Sided Detection17. Lead Insulation18. EOL Testing
